Transaction 6effe0696d765b81c24653e2417a1907acf95b83c1716abc254f1626774455e0
1 Input
1 Output
-
6effe0696d765b81c24653e2417a1907acf95b83c1716abc254f1626774455e0:0
- value
- 105785562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 777a45723c59ab99eb2df00c58ee729d193fb99f OP_EQUAL
- address
- MJnu7pECt8Fb4dmwtCRbapwhBjj2yfCvVT